Itinerary Overview:

  • Duration: 1 day
  • Best Time to Visit: Spring through Fall (May to October)
  • Entrance Gate: West Yellowstone Entrance
  • Exit Gate: South Entrance

Morning: Geothermal Marvels at West Thumb Geyser Basin

7:00 AM: Start your day early by entering Yellowstone through the West Yellowstone Entrance. I can tell you firsthand that the earlier you can enter (When we visited, 7 am was the opening time), the better! Fewer tour buses during the 7 am hour for sure.

As the sun rises, the glistening waters of Yellowstone Lake will welcome you to the park. Your first stop is the West Thumb Geyser Basin, located conveniently near the entrance. Explore the boardwalk trails that wind around hot springs, geysers, and pools, offering a mesmerizing display of colors and geothermal activity.

Mid-morning: Grand Canyon of Yellowstone and Artist Point

9:00 AM: Head north towards the Grand Canyon of Yellowstone, an awe-inspiring sight that showcases the park’s geological wonders. Stop at the Artist Point overlook to take in the breathtaking view of the Lower Falls and the vibrant canyon walls. Capture the beauty of the roaring falls against the backdrop of the colorful rock formations.

Late Morning: Mammoth Hot Springs Terraces

11:00 AM: Drive to the Mammoth Hot Springs area, located in the northern part of the park. This was my favorite place in the whole park. Explore the terraces, a surreal landscape created by the interaction of hot water with limestone.

The intricate formations resemble cascading steps and terraces, making for a truly unique sight. Don’t miss the opportunity to capture the contrast of white mineral deposits against the surrounding greenery.

Lunch Break: Roosevelt Arch and Picnic Area

1:00 PM: Enjoy a relaxing picnic lunch at the Roosevelt Arch and Picnic Area near the North Entrance. This historic arch is a gateway to the park and a great spot to snap photos and stretch your legs.

Afternoon: Wildlife Encounters at Hayden Valley

2:00 PM: Drive south towards the Hayden Valley, a prime location for wildlife viewing. This expansive meadow is home to a variety of animals, including bison, elk, wolves, and grizzly bears. Keep your binoculars handy and scan the landscape for these magnificent creatures as you drive through the valley.

Late Afternoon: Old Faithful and Upper Geyser Basin

4:00 PM: Head towards the iconic Old Faithful area in the southwestern part of the park. Everyone comes here to see this. Personally, for me, it was the least of my favorites. I’m including it because it is an iconic thing to do. Arrive in time to witness the renowned Old Faithful geyser erupt, sending a powerful jet of steam and water into the air.

Afterward, explore the nearby Upper Geyser Basin, home to an array of geysers and hot springs. Take a stroll on the boardwalks and marvel at the otherworldly features.

Evening: Grand Prismatic Spring and Exiting the Park

6:00 PM: Your last stop of the day is the mesmerizing Grand Prismatic Spring. As the sun begins to set, the vivid colors of the spring create a surreal and almost ethereal atmosphere. Capture the vibrant blue, green, and orange hues as steam rises from the hot spring. Everyone wants to do this first, but I highly recommend that it is last on your list. The sunset really makes the colors pop. I also highly recommend viewing it from above. It’s a short hike up a clearly marked path, where you can see all three pools.

7:00 PM: Finally, exit the park through the South Entrance as the day comes to a close. Reflect on the incredible sights you’ve seen and the memories you’ve made during your whirlwind journey through Yellowstone.

BONUS: If you didn’t run out of time, I highly recommend the Bubbling Mud. The pictures don’t do this attraction justice, but it is unique and extraordinary to see.
